Cultivating Calm: A Mindfulness Meditation Guide

In today's fast-paced world, it can be difficult to find moments of peace and tranquility. Stress, anxiety, and constant stimulation are prevalent experiences that can leave us feeling overwhelmed and spent. Mindfulness meditation offers a powerful tool for cultivating calm and restoring balance within.

Embark your mindfulness journey by finding a quiet space where you may relax undisturbed. Sit or lie down in a comfortable position, close your eyes gently, and bring your attention to your breath. Notice the gentle flow of inhalation and exhalation.

As you concentrate your awareness to your breath, thoughts may appear. That's perfectly normal. Merely acknowledge these thoughts without criticizing them, and gradually redirect your attention back to your breath.

With consistent practice, mindfulness meditation can help you in cultivating a greater sense of consciousness. You may find yourself feeling greater levels of calm, focus, and emotional regulation in your daily life. Furthermore, mindfulness meditation has been shown to decrease stress hormones and foster overall well-being.

Think about incorporating a few minutes of mindfulness meditation into your day, and experience the transformative power of cultivating calm within.
